About the Pontiac
The Pontiac is a rock ‘n’ roll craft cocktail bar helmed by Beckaly Franks, the first female mixologist to win the prestigious 42 Below Cocktail World Cup. The Pontiac is an inclusive collaboration between bar and guest. Inspired by the neighbourhood watering holes of Portland, Brooklyn and San Francisco, The Pontiac is focused on inclusivity and community. The Pontiac has been the proud recipient of Asia’s 50 Best Bars for seven consecutive years from 2016 to 2022.
